FAQs

Can I use these boots on artificial grass (AG) pitches?

No, the Nike Phantom GX 2 Elite FG boots are specifically designed for Firm Ground (FG) natural grass pitches. Using them on artificial grass can reduce traction, accelerate wear, and potentially invalidate warranties.

How do I clean my football boots?

Remove loose dirt with a soft brush, then wipe with a damp cloth and mild soap if needed. Do not machine wash. Allow them to air dry completely at room temperature, away from direct heat.

Are these boots true to size?

Nike boots generally fit true to size for most users. However, foot shape varies. It's recommended to try them on to ensure the best fit. Consider wearing your typical football socks when trying them on.

How long will my boots last?

The lifespan of your boots depends heavily on frequency of use, playing conditions, and proper care. With regular cleaning and appropriate use on firm ground, high-quality boots can last for several seasons.

What does 'Elite FG' mean?

'Elite' indicates Nike's top-tier performance model, featuring premium materials and advanced technologies. 'FG' stands for Firm Ground, meaning the soleplate is designed for optimal traction on natural grass pitches that are firm and dry.

Setup, Compatibility & Care Instructions

Setup

  1. Lacing: Ensure the boots are laced securely but not excessively tight. Adjust to your comfort to prevent pressure points and allow for blood flow.
  2. Break-in Period: Like all high-performance football boots, the Phantom GX 2 Elite FG may benefit from a short break-in period. Wear them for light training sessions or walks initially to mold them to your feet before intense matches.

Compatibility

  • Surface: These boots are exclusively designed for Firm Ground (FG) pitches, which means natural grass fields that are relatively dry. Using them on artificial turf (AG) or soft, muddy ground (SG) can compromise performance, damage the boots, and potentially lead to injury.
  • Footwear: Wear appropriate football socks that offer cushioning and prevent blisters, especially during the break-in phase.

Care

  1. Cleaning: After each use, remove loose dirt and grass with a soft brush or cloth. Wipe the upper with a damp cloth. For stubborn dirt, use a mild soap solution, but avoid harsh chemicals.
  2. Drying: Allow the boots to air dry naturally at room temperature. Do not use direct heat sources like radiators or tumble dryers, as this can damage the materials and adhesives. Stuff them with newspaper to absorb moisture and help maintain their shape.
  3. Storage: Store your boots in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ight when not in use. A boot bag can protect them from dust and scuffs.
  4. Inspection: Regularly check the studs for wear and tear. Damaged studs can affect traction and lead to instability.
